Technique of Forcing in Alpine Flowering for Phalaenopsis in Western Fujian

Abstract
Effects of mountain altitude, processing time, light intensity, fertilizer composition in the flowering of Phalaenopsis were discussed in the paper. Results showed that the mountain altitude affected directly to Phalaenopsis in flowering and the proper time applied to force flowering in mountain was the key. In addition, sufficient light and increased Phosphorus Potassium in fertilizer enhanced the development and growth of flower bud. The results suggest that, in Western Fujian, optimum conditions for forcing flower bud differentiation and growth are following: processing during mid-August, bringing mature Butterfly Orchid to 1 100-1 200 m in mountain altitude, with 20 000 - 25 000 lx light and complex fertilizer in N: P2 O5 :K2 O as 9: 45: 15, respectively. The maturity of Butterfly Orchid is in the seedling age of 16 mouths with leaf coronary reached (30± 2) cm. By a 45 - 50 day treatment period, the bud germination rate reached 96%, the length of flower stems was over 10cm and the flowers were growing well.关键词
